And Saha has completed his move to the Toffees on a 2year deal.
“I am quite disappointed my time with United has finished like this, with so many injury problems,” he told the official Everton website. “But I am very happy a club of Everton’s stature have shown they are interested in me.
“There is European football for one thing, and I was very impressed when I spoke to their manager David Moyes. He told me exactly how he wanted me to play. He was very honest with me.
“I also spoke to Sir Alex Ferguson and he said it would be good for me to sign for Everton because I would get the chance to play more than at United. He also thought it would help my fitness if I was playing every week.”
